Introduction: The Secret to Mastering Oral English in Job Interviews

Mastering oral English in job interviews can be challenging, but with the right strategies, it is possible to overcome these difficulties and communicate effectively. This article will provide you with a step-by-step guide to help you overcome common obstacles and improve your oral English skills.

Analyzing the Job Requirements: Understanding What Employers Look For

Before the interview, it is crucial to thoroughly analyze the job requirements to understand what employers are looking for in a candidate. By doing so, you can tailor your answers to highlight your strengths and relevant experiences. Take your time to research and familiarize yourself with the company's values, mission, and culture to demonstrate your genuine interest.

Preparing for Common Questions: Be Prepared and Confident

Preparing for common interview questions is essential to ensure you are confident and articulate during the conversation. Practice answering questions related to your strengths, weaknesses, past experiences, and problem-solving abilities. By rehearsing your answers, you can develop a clear and concise communication style that will leave a lasting impression on the interviewer.

Showcasing Your Achievements: Highlight Your Skills and Accomplishments

During the interview, it is important to showcase your achievements to demonstrate your skills and capabilities. Use specific examples and quantify your accomplishments whenever possible. This will provide credibility to your claims and make it easier for the interviewer to evaluate your suitability for the job.

Active Listening: Pay Attention and Respond Appropriately

Active listening is a crucial skill in effective communication. Paying attention to the interviewer's questions and comments allows you to respond appropriately and demonstrate your understanding. Practice paraphrasing and clarifying questions to ensure you fully comprehend the interviewer's intentions before answering.

Body Language and Non-verbal Cues: Make a Positive Impression

Apart from verbal communication, your body language and non-verbal cues also play a significant role in making a positive impression. Maintain eye contact, use appropriate facial expressions, and display confident posture throughout the interview. Remember to smile and nod to show your engagement and interest in the conversation.

Mastering the Art of Small Talk: Build Rapport with the Interviewer

Small talk is often used to build rapport and establish a connection with the interviewer. Prepare a few ice-breaking questions or topics related to the company or industry to initiate a casual conversation. This will help you create a friendly atmosphere and leave a memorable impression on the interviewer.

Handling Difficult Questions: Remaining Calm Under Pressure

Difficult questions are common in job interviews, and it is crucial to remain calm and composed when faced with such challenges. Take a moment to collect your thoughts, and if necessary, ask for clarification or more time to formulate your response. Respond confidently and honestly, highlighting your abilities and addressing any concerns raised.
